2 more days off for National Day to fulfill the dream of taking my child to the new school year

Speaking at a press conference to inform about the results of the 13th Congress of the Vietnam Trade Union for the 2023-2028 term, on the morning of December 3, Vice President of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or Ngo Duy Hieu provided detailed information about the proposal to add 2 more days off for the National Day of September 2 for union members and workers that was just raised.

According to Mr. Hieu, at the time of collecting opinions on the 2019 Labor Code, the drafting agency provided information on the number of holidays in Southeast Asian countries and around the world. The number of holidays and Tet holidays in Southeast Asian countries ranges from 15 to 16 days a year, of which our country only has 11 holidays.

"We set out to increase the number of holidays in the year from now on," Mr. Hieu said.

Discussing why the proposal to add 2 more days off on the occasion of National Day on September 2nd was chosen, until the opening day of school, the Vice President of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or said that currently, the National Day holiday is 2 days off, union members and workers want to take an additional day off until September 5th to have the conditions to take their children to the opening day of school.

"For assembly line workers, taking their children to school on the first day of school is a dream, so the proposal is to increase the number of days off for National Day, September 2. This ensures that the wishes of workers are met," said Mr. Hieu.

This person added that when workers' lives get better and their incomes get higher, the issue of increasing the number of holidays in a year will arise.

Previously, in the report on the recommendations of union members and workers to the 13th Congress of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or, union members proposed to study increasing annual holidays and Tet holidays at an appropriate time. The reason is that the number of holidays in Vietnam is currently 5-6 days lower than the average of Southeast Asian countries and the world.

Specifically, workers hope to add 2 more days off for National Day, to extend the holiday from September 2 to September 5, creating an opportunity for workers and laborers to take their children to school on the first day of school.

The union's summary report said that this is the earnest wish of the majority of workers with school-age children.

According to Article 112 of the 2019 Labor Code, from 2021, employees will have a total of 11 paid holidays and Tet. Specifically:

New Year's Day: 1 day off (January 1); Lunar New Year: 5 days off; Hung King's Commemoration Day: 1 day off (March 10th of Lunar calendar); Victory Day: 1 day off on April 30; International Labor Day: 1 day off on May 1; National Day: 2 days off on September 2 (September 2 and 1 day before or after).

If these holidays coincide with weekly holidays, employees will be given compensatory days off on the following day. Every year, based on actual conditions, the Prime Minister decides on specific holidays according to regulations.
